Journal of Metallic Materials (JMM) ISSN 2657-747X is a quarterly that publishes original results of studies conducted at Łukasiewicz Research Network – Institute for Ferrous Metallurgy and research units of a similar profile of interest that cooperate with the Institute, as well as review papers from various fields related to the steel industry.
Articles in English are preferred. In exceptional cases, the Editorial Board provides for the possibility of translating the article into English after consultation with the Author.

2. REVIEWING PROCESS
To ensure that principles of publishing ethics and scientific reliability are abided by, the Editorial Board of the JMM applies the “double-blind review process”, i.e. double concealment of identity during the review process – neither the Author nor the Reviewer know each other’s’ names. Names of Reviewers of particular papers shall not be revealed. The list of Reviewers cooperating with the Editorial Board in a given year is given in the last issue of the journal, without specifying particular papers they reviewed.
Stages of review:
- Following the approval of the paper by the Managing Editor and/or Editorial Team, it is submitted to two independent Reviewers selected from among recognised authorities in a given field.
- In assessment of the received text, the Reviewer shall apply the principle of impartiality as well as shall refrain from using ad-hominem argumentation.
- The Reviewer is obliged to indicate missing items in the documentation of sources in the text or potential plagiarism, on the presence of which they shall immediately inform the Editorial Board.
- Following a positive assessment of the Reviewer, the text is transferred to the Author who shall introduce the correction recommended in the reviews.
- If the Author disagrees with the Reviewer’s remarks, the Author shall prepare a response to the review.
- In specific cases, upon the request of the Reviewer, the paper may be submitted to re- review.
- The Author is obliged to introduce the correction recommended by the Reviewer. Failure to respond to the opinion and introduce the proposed corrections shall result in the paper being rejected from publishing in the quarterly JMM.
Note! The Reviewer is obliged to refuse to review the submitted text in case of any conflict of interests and notify the Editorial Team on such.
3. EDITORIAL GUIDELINES FOR PREPARATION OF PUBLICATION
- Provide the affiliation (name and address of the employer) of the Author(s) and the e-mail address of the Author representing the team, as a footnote on the first page of the paper.
- An abstract in Polish and English shall be provided under the title and its translation. The Authors shall prepare abstracts and their translations, which shall then be verified by the translator cooperating with the Editorial Board.
- Keywords shall be provided in Polish and English under the abstract; min. 5 and max. 10 words.
- Sections included in the paper, e.g. Introduction, Methods, Results, Discussion, Conclusions, shall be numbered.
- Captions for figures and tables shall be in Polish and English.
- Graphs, images and drawings shall be included as figures and numbered consecutively.
- References to figures and tables in the text shall be put in round brackets, e.g. (Fig. 2), (Table 3), while references to literature shall be provided in square brackets, e.g. [7], [1-4] or [2, 3, 9].
- Figures shall be in colour or black and white, in the min. resolution of 300 dpi. They shall be attached as separate files as TIF (preferred) or JPG, PDF (maximum quality or print quality required).
- Chemical equations and mathematical formulas shall be provided in a separate line and numbered in round brackets, e.g. (2).

4. FINAL REMARKS
The Editorial Board shall refuse to publish the author’s materials when:
- any cases of scientific unreliability, in particular cases of “Ghost-writing” and “Guest Authorship”, are revealed,
- the author does not agree to introduce the required corrections of the content proposed by the Reviewer or Editorial Board.
The Editorial Board shall also accept for publication only papers which are the original creation of the Author, do not breach the rights of third parties or have not yet been published or submitted for publishing.
